How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Canton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Canton Studio Apartments | $1,810 | $900 | $2,552 |
Canton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,175 | $1,050 | $4,407 |
Canton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,672 | $1,175 | $8,813 |
Canton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,545 | $1,370 | $5,256 |
Canton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,412 | $3,577 | $5,526 |

Largest Available Canton and Nearby Studio Apartments
The largest available Studio apartment unit in Canton, CT is found at Alexandria Manor in the Bloomfield Windsor neighborhood and is 627 square feet priced from $1,699. The Preserve at Great Pond in the Poquonock neighborhood has the second largest Studio, which is sized at 622 square feet and currently listed start at $1,895. Here is today’s list of the largest available Studio units in Canton:
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Square Footage | Priced From |
---|---|---|---|
Alexandria Manor | Studio | 627 Sq Ft | $1,699 |
The Preserve at Great Pond | Anderson | 622 Sq Ft | $1,895 |
Gilbert Clock Apartments | Studio | 600 Sq Ft | $900 |
Cheapest Available Canton and Nearby Studio Apartments
As of March 26, 2025 the lowest priced Studio apartment unit in Canton, CT is the Studio Model starting from $900 at Gilbert Clock Apartments . The second most affordable Canton Studio is the Studio 1 Balcony Model at Simsbury Center Apartments starting at $1,595 in the West Granby neighborhood. The average price for all Studio apartments in Canton is currently $1,810.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available Studio options in Canton:
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
---|---|---|
Gilbert Clock Apartments | Studio | $900 |
Simsbury Center Apartments | Studio 1 Balcony | $1,595 |
Alexandria Manor | Studio | $1,699 |
